Honda Fit Power Train Automatic Transmission Safety Report | Feb 01, 2007
Reported on Feb 01, 2007
CONTINUING PROBLEM WITH 2007 HONDA FIT AUTOMATIC TRANSMISSION HESITATION TO DOWN SHIFT AT 2-5 MPH, SUCH AS ROLLING STOPS AT YIELD SIGNS. WHEN YOU STEP DOWN ON ACCELERATOR TRANSMISSION SEEMS TO GET CONFUSED AND DOES NOT ALLOW ACCELERATION AT ALL FOR 2-3 SECONDS. IT IS OKAY IF COMPLETELY STOPPED, BUT NOT FROM A ROLLING STOP. THIS IS VERY DANGEROUS, AND HAS ALMOST CAUSED AN ACCIDENT SEVERAL TIMES. THE HONDA DEALER ACKNOWLEDGED THAT THIS WAS A DEFECT, BUT HONDA TECHNICAL SUPPORT SAID THE FIT MODELS ALL DO IT, AND THERE WAS NOTHING THAT COULD BE DONE ABOUT IT. *AK | |
